What is SSL proxy?

SSL proxy is a transparent proxy that performs SSL encryption and decryption between the client and the server. SRX acts as the server from the client’s perspective and it acts as the client from the server’s perspective.

How do I filter HTTPS in Wireshark?

Observe the traffic captured in the top Wireshark packet list pane. To view only HTTPS traffic, type ssl (lower case) in the Filter box and press Enter. Select the first TLS packet labeled Client Hello. Observe the destination IP address.

What is SSL proxy load balancer?

SSL Proxy Load Balancing is a reverse proxy load balancer that distributes SSL traffic coming from the internet to virtual machine (VM) instances in your Google Cloud VPC network.

How does SSL forward proxy work?

When application firewall (AppFW) is configured, SSL forward proxy acts as an SSL server terminating the SSL session from the client and a new SSL session is established to the server. The device decrypts and then re-encrypts all SSL forward proxy traffic.

What is SSL bypass in proxy?

The SSL Decryption Bypass option enables you to define specific websites that are not subject to decryption as they flow through the proxy. Some websites may include personal identification information that should not be decrypted.

Is SSL used anymore?

Transport Layer Security (TLS) is the successor protocol to SSL. TLS is an improved version of SSL. It works in much the same way as the SSL, using encryption to protect the transfer of data and information. The two terms are often used interchangeably in the industry although SSL is still widely used.
